Each technology has distinct strengths. We help you select the optimal method based on your part’s requirements, timeline, and budget.
The fastest and most cost-effective path to a physical prototype. Thermoplastic filament is extruded layer by layer to produce durable, functional parts ideal for fit checks, enclosure testing, and mechanical validation. Turnaround as fast as 24 hours for simple geometries.
Best For: Functional testing, enclosures, jigs & fixtures, proof-of-concept models
UV-cured resin delivers exceptional surface finish and fine feature resolution down to 50 microns. Ideal for visual prototypes, investor presentations, and any application where appearance and dimensional precision matter more than raw mechanical strength.
Best For: Visual models, fine detail, presentation prototypes, form checks
When your prototype must match production material properties and tolerances, CNC machining delivers. Parts are cut from solid billet aluminum, steel, brass, or engineering plastics with tolerances as tight as ±0.001″. The result is a prototype indistinguishable from a final production part.
Best For: Metal parts, production-quality prototypes, load-bearing components

Our fastest turnaround is 48 hours for simple FDM or SLA prototypes using in-stock materials. Standard projects with full CAD design and manufacturing typically ship within 5–7 business days. Complex multi-part assemblies with custom materials take 2–3 weeks. We provide a firm delivery date during the quoting phase and stand behind it — honest timelines are a core part of how we do business.
Absolutely. Many prototyping projects start without a CAD file. Send us a hand sketch, a photo, a napkin drawing, a verbal description, or even a competitor’s product you want to improve. We will develop a full 3D model in Fusion 360 or SolidWorks as part of the prototyping package. Design-from-scratch is one of our core strengths — backed by 15 years of CAD experience.
Every prototyping package includes up to 2 design revisions at no additional cost. After testing your prototype, share your feedback and we will update the CAD model and manufacture a revised part. Additional revisions beyond the included two are available at a transparent hourly rate ($85/hr for design time plus material and manufacturing costs). Most projects reach final approval within 1–2 revision cycles.
Pricing depends on complexity, material, technology, and turnaround time. We provide free, no-obligation quotes for every project. To give you a rough idea: most single-part prototypes fall in the $150–$1,200 range, including CAD design, manufacturing, and shipping. Simple FDM parts start around $150. Complex CNC-machined metal assemblies are at the higher end. Rush surcharges apply for 48-hour turnaround. You will always know the exact price before we begin.
